  • 10
    Scored 10

    Amazing old town , with its wonderful rennaissance buildings...

    Amazing old town , with its wonderful rennaissance buildings and piazza Recomend not miss to visit the Duomo (Cathedral) of S. Maria Assunta: The Romanesque edifice contains the tomb of Filippo Lippi. The church also houses a manuscript letter by Saint Francis of Assisi. Basilica of San Salvatore: 4th-5th century church Early Christian architecture. A UNESCO World Heritage Site
